More about the brand Bocci


The Canadian company Bocci is known for fantastic pendant lights made of glass, designed by Omer Arbel.

Bocci was founded in 2005 by Omer Arbel and Randy Bishop. Arbel acts as the brand's art director and chief designer. The range focuses on just a few collections, each with its own character and inimitable charm. As a rule, the Bocci lights are made of glass, but metal or ceramics are also used. Melting, casting and other technical, often experimental techniques give the materials unique shapes with fascinating irregularities that make each lamp unique, even a work of art.

Instead of normal names, Omer Arbel gives his works sequential numbers. Not every designer's idea is implemented in series - the first lamp in the Bocci range was number 14 - but often the different designs build on one another, think old ideas further and play with shape, color and material. These understandable thoughts behind the designs, which run like a red thread through the range and ensure coherence, are what make the lights from Bocci so special.

Each lamp usually exists as a single version as well as multiple combinations, whereby individual made-to-measure products are also possible. In addition to its regular range of lights, Bocci also takes care of projects and light installations of inimitable complexity, sensuality and lively magic.
